This townhouse in Dubai was designed for a young couple at the beginning of their life together. The brief was straightforward in the best possible way: a home that feels light, considered, and genuinely theirs.
The interior moves between open and enclosed, generous shared spaces on the ground floor that invite daily life to unfold freely, and quieter, more defined rooms above that offer privacy and separation when the day calls for it. The two registers work together, giving the couple a home that can hold both the energy of living together and the stillness of retreating into one's own space.
The atmosphere throughout is light and airy. Natural materials, wood and stone, bring warmth and texture without weighing the interior down. Custom joinery gives each space its quiet structure, built-in elements that serve without imposing. Soft furnishings layer in comfort and personality, completing a home that feels finished but never rigid.
Dubai can sometimes push interiors toward the heavy and the ornate. This townhouse goes the other way. Calm, precise, and full of light.
